Judge-shopping is a practice where multiple lawsuits asserting the same claim are filed in the hopes of having one assigned to a favorable judge1. It is considered an abuse of the court system.
A conflict of interest refers to an interest that disqualifies a judge1. A judicial or arbitral decision consists of taking a side in such a conflict, allowing one interest to prevail over another in a reasoned way2. The Code of Conduct for United States Judges provides guidelines for conflicts of interest.
Here is the judicial code of conduct for Texas.
Canon 4: Conducting the Judge's Extra-Judicial Activities to Minimize the Risk of Conflict with Judicial Obligations A. Extra-Judicial Activities in General. A judge shall conduct all of the judge's extrajudicial activities so that they do not1) cast reasonable doubt on the judge's capacity to act impartially as a judge; or (2) interfere with the proper performance of judicial duties
